Domestic airport shuttle bus services primarily cater to travelers flying within the same country. These services are often characterized by shorter distances, frequent departures, and higher frequency of local passengers. Domestic airport transfers are highly dependent on regional demand, flight schedules, and airport traffic, which often results in greater flexibility in the service offerings. For example, many domestic routes offer non-stop services, providing faster and more direct access to and from terminals. These buses also tend to be more accessible to locals who regularly travel for business or leisure purposes, with routes often extending to nearby cities or local transportation hubs, offering seamless connectivity to regional transportation networks.
Domestic airport shuttle buses are also typically more cost-effective and provide a high level of convenience, particularly for frequent flyers and budget-conscious travelers. Given the proximity of travel within the country, these services tend to have a high level of efficiency, offering shorter travel times compared to international routes. Furthermore, domestic services are less regulated compared to international shuttle transfers, which can allow operators to offer a broader range of services, including discounted or promotional fares. With domestic travel growing in many regions, particularly in emerging markets, shuttle services at domestic airports are expected to see continued demand, driven by the need for reliable, frequent, and affordable transportation options.
International airport shuttle bus services cater to travelers flying between countries, which often involves longer distances, complex logistics, and varying airport regulations. These shuttle services generally face more stringent security measures and international travel protocols, impacting how services are designed and operated. International transfer buses may also involve additional procedures such as customs checks, especially for passengers traveling between specific international hubs. These services are tailored to accommodate travelers who are likely to have longer layovers or require transfers between multiple terminals or even nearby airports. As a result, international shuttle buses often provide additional amenities such as luggage handling services, Wi-Fi, and multilingual support to enhance the passenger experience.
For international airports, shuttle buses must be able to handle the diverse and often fluctuating demands of passengers from different regions and cultures. The key challenge in international airport transfers is ensuring smooth connections, given the potential for delays or scheduling conflicts between flights from different time zones or airlines. Moreover, due to the larger scale of international travel, the shuttles often operate on a larger capacity scale, catering to bigger groups of passengers. Despite the added complexities, international airport shuttle services are vital for facilitating connections, and their role is expected to continue growing as global travel volumes rise, especially in hubs with increasing numbers of international passengers.
Several key trends are shaping the airport transfer shuttle bus market. First, there is an increasing demand for eco-friendly transportation solutions. Many airport shuttle services are adopting electric or hybrid buses to reduce carbon emissions and meet stricter environmental regulations. This shift is driven by both consumer preference for sustainable travel options and government policies that promote green transportation. The adoption of electric shuttle buses not only helps improve sustainability but also reduces operational costs over time, making them an attractive option for service providers.
Another prominent trend is the growing integration of technology in shuttle bus operations. Many shuttle services are implementing advanced digital booking systems, real-time tracking, and mobile apps to improve customer convenience and streamline operations. Passengers can now easily book their shuttle services, track bus arrivals, and receive updates on delays, enhancing their overall experience. Additionally, some shuttle services are incorporating AI-based route optimization to reduce travel times and fuel consumption, which further contributes to operational efficiency. With the increasing reliance on smartphones and digital tools, the role of technology in the shuttle bus market will continue to expand.
